My Buying Guides on 2.5 Qt Slow Cooker

Why I Considered a 2.5 Qt Slow Cooker

When I started looking for a slow cooker, I realized that a 2.5 qt size was the sweet spot for my needs. It felt ideal for small families, couples, meal prep, side dishes, and even dips or desserts. I did not want a bulky appliance taking up too much counter space, and I also wanted something that would not waste energy when I was cooking smaller portions.

What I Looked for in Size and Capacity

The first thing I checked was whether 2.5 quarts would actually fit my cooking habits. I found that this size works well for about 2 to 3 servings, depending on the recipe. For me, that meant I could make soups, stews, chili, shredded chicken, or a small roast without having leftovers for days. I also liked that it was easy to store in my kitchen cabinets.

Why Material and Build Quality Mattered to Me

I paid close attention to the inner pot and outer body. I preferred a ceramic or stoneware insert because it held heat well and cleaned up easily. I also looked for a sturdy lid that sealed properly, since I did not want moisture escaping during long cooking times. A durable handle and solid base gave me more confidence that the cooker would last.

Features I Found Most Useful

I liked models with simple controls because I did not need anything complicated. A low, high, and warm setting was usually enough for my needs. I also appreciated a keep-warm function, especially when I was not ready to eat right away. Some models had a removable insert that was dishwasher safe, and that made cleanup much easier for me.

How I Judged Ease of Use

I always prefer appliances that are straightforward, and that was true here too. I looked for a slow cooker with clear labels, easy-to-turn knobs, and a lid that I could lift without hassle. If I had to guess settings or struggle with buttons, I knew I would use it less often. Simplicity made the biggest difference in my experience.

Cleaning and Maintenance Tips I Kept in Mind

I wanted a cooker that would not become a chore after dinner. A removable stoneware pot was important to me because I could wash it separately. I also checked whether the lid and insert were dishwasher safe. For my own routine, I found that soaking the pot shortly after cooking helped remove stuck-on food much more easily.

What I Considered for Safety

Safety was important in my buying decision. I looked for cool-touch handles, a stable base, and a lid that fit securely. I also made sure the cooker had reliable temperature control so I would not worry about overcooking. Since I sometimes left food cooking while I was busy, I wanted a model I could trust.

How I Compared Price and Value

I did not want to buy the cheapest option just to save money. Instead, I looked for the best value based on durability, performance, and convenience. In my experience, a well-made 2.5 qt slow cooker is worth paying a little more for if it cooks evenly and lasts longer. I found that good value mattered more than extra features I would rarely use.

My Final Buying Advice

If I were choosing a 2.5 qt slow cooker again, I would focus on capacity, durability, ease of cleaning, and simple controls. I found that this size is perfect for smaller meals and everyday use. For me, the best slow cooker was the one that fit my kitchen, matched my cooking style, and made meal prep easier without adding extra work.
